Nations League: Flick relies on returnees

2022-05-19T14:21:10.381Z


National soccer coach Hansi Flick has nominated many established players for the Nations League. However, a few EM participants are missing - and Simon Terodde is being observed.

With the 26-man squad for the upcoming Nations League games in June, Hansi Flick is already sending clear signals for the World Cup in Qatar.

In the games against teams such as European champions Italy and the European Championship finalists England, the national football coach no longer tests newcomers, but relies on established players.

Compared to the internationals in March, Flick can again count on regulars like the Bayern quartet with Niklas Süle, Joshua Kimmich, Leon Goretzka and Serge Gnabry.

Marco Reus, Karim Adeyemi, Jonas Hofmann, Lukas Klostermann and goalkeeper Oliver Baumann are also celebrating a comeback in the DFB team.

“This is not a final squad for the World Cup.

The door is open,” said Flick in a media round on Thursday.

But the 57-year-old also emphasized: “The squad that is there now is the measure of all things in terms of trunk.” This is a clear indication of some World Cup candidates.

There is also a Frankfurt match winner

Players such as last year's European Championship participants Matthias Ginter (Mönchengladbach) and Robin Gosens (Inter Milan) are missing from the squad, which will initially meet on Monday for a short training camp with family members in Marbella, Spain.

Florian Neuhaus from Gladbach and Christian Günter from Freiburg were not invited this time either.

Paris Saint-Germain's Julian Draxler is currently injured.

"I understand anyone who is disappointed," said Flick, "I know that they take it as an incentive." His nomination criteria?

"We have made it very clear to the players what we expect: that they have playing practice and rhythm, that they are developing."

For goalkeeper Marc-André ter Stegen, who is scheduled to take a break in the summer, Hoffenheim’s Oliver Baumann is the third keeper alongside captain Manuel Neuer and Frankfurt Europa League winner Kevin Trapp.

Even after his strong performance in the final on Wednesday evening in Seville against Glasgow Rangers, Flick confirmed that 31-year-old Trapp was in “outstanding form” and that he was developing very well.

»Terodde is a striker who scores a lot of goals – now in the 2nd division«

Flick also praised second division top scorer Simon Terodde for his outstanding goal record at newly promoted FC Schalke 04 and gave him a minimal chance of making the national soccer team and taking part in the World Cup.

The 34-year-old Terodde had just described international matches for Germany as a personal dream and scored 30 goals for Schalke this season.

"Simon Terodde is already a striker who scores a lot of goals - now in the 2nd division," said Flick, and: "We'll see how next season looks like, whether he can score goals in the premier division".

What applies to all World Cup candidates applies to him: "If he plays at a top level - that's the Bundesliga - and performs well there and scores his goals, all doors and gates are open."

After the training camp in Spain (May 23-27), Flick gives his squad two days off.

On May 30, the DFB selection will meet in Herzogenaurach to prepare for the four Nations League games in Bologna against Italy (June 4), in Munich against England (June 7), in Budapest against Hungary (June 11). . June) and prepare again in Mönchengladbach against Italy (14 June).

"These games are a great opportunity for us to show how far we've come," said Flick, looking ahead to the World Cup finals in Qatar, which begin on November 21.
